Are we talking about the state mandatory testing or assessments being implemented throughout the school year with common core?
Common core was a disaster here in NY this year. They just rolled it out too broad, too fast, and could we please have educators writing the curriculum???
I ask the question, however, because parents can opt their kid(s) out of state mandatory testing, which i wanted to do with one of my children. HOWEVER, I was informed by the principal that the school would lose all annual state funding for him if I made that choice. The school loses state funding for each child who opts out. (5% of the student body are allowed to miss - or opt out of - the test unpunished.) Since I live in a college town, many students leave with their parents for 6 to 12 months to go on sabbatical. They are, however, still enrolled in the school, just gone for a while. So, our 5% is eaten up pretty quickly. i am left having to choose between what is best for my child or what is best for his school. it's a bullshit law, but it was implemented here in NY to put parents in this position.
